Questions & Answers

What companies run services between Cottbus, Germany and Berlin, Germany?

Deutsche Bahn Regio (DB Regional) operates a train from Cottbus, Hauptbahnhof to S+U Alexanderplatz Bhf hourly. Tickets cost €19–28 and the journey takes 1h 25m. Deutsche Bahn Intercity (DB IC) also services this route twice daily. Alternatively, FlixBus operates a bus from Cottbus bus station to Berlin, Zentralen Omnibusbahnhof once daily. Tickets cost €9–16 and the journey takes 2h.
